
1. 엑셀의 만능 해결사, IF 함수란 무엇일까요?
안녕하세요! 혹시 엑셀을 사용하면서 "만약 점수가 80점 이상이면 '합격', 아니면 '불합격'이라고 표시하고 싶다"는 고민을 해보신 적 있나요? 이럴 때 사용하는 것이 바로 엑셀의 '꽃'이라 불리는 IF 함수입니다.
IF 함수는 우리 일상의 의사결정과 매우 닮아 있습니다. "내일 비가 오면 집에서 영화를 보고, 안 오면 공원에 가야지!"라는 생각 자체가 이미 IF 함수의 논리 구조죠. 엑셀에서의 기본 형식은 다음과 같습니다.
=IF(조건문, 참일_때_결과, 거짓일_때_결과)
하지만 실무에서는 조건이 하나만 있는 경우는 드뭅니다. "80점 이상은 A, 70점 이상은 B, 나머지는 F"처럼 조건이 여러 단계로 나뉘는 경우가 훨씬 많죠. 이럴 때 필요한 기술이 바로 '중첩'입니다.
2. 한계를 넘어서는 '중첩 IF' 함수 활용법
중첩 IF 함수란, 말 그대로 IF 함수 안에 또 다른 IF 함수를 '넣어서' 사용하는 방식입니다. 러시아의 인형 마트료시카를 떠올리면 이해가 빠르실 거예요. 첫 번째 문을 열었을 때 원하는 답이 없으면, 두 번째 문을 열어 확인하는 식이죠.
다중 조건 처리하기
예를 들어, 성적 처리 시스템을 만든다고 가정해 봅시다. 기준은 다음과 같습니다.
- 90점 이상: "최우수"
- 80점 이상: "우수"
- 그 외: "노력필요"
이 논리를 함수로 표현하면 이렇게 됩니다.
여기서 중요한 포인트는 순서입니다. 큰 범위부터 차례대로 걸러내야 엑셀이 헷갈리지 않고 정확한 결과를 내놓습니다. 만약 80점 조건을 먼저 쓰면, 90점인 사람도 80점 조건에 걸려 '우수'라고 나오고 끝나버리니까요!

3. AND, OR, NOT: 논리 연산자로 조건의 품격 높이기
중첩 IF만으로도 훌륭하지만, 조건이 "A이면서 B여야 한다"거나 "A 또는 B 중 하나만 만족해도 된다"면 어떻게 할까요? 이때 등장하는 구원투수가 바로 논리 연산자(AND, OR, NOT)입니다.
| 연산자 | 의미 | 사용 예시 |
|---|---|---|
| AND | 모든 조건이 참일 때 | AND(출석률>=90, 점수>=80) |
| OR | 하나라도 참일 때 | OR(자격증보유="O", 경력>=3) |
| NOT | 조건이 거짓일 때 (반전) | NOT(부서="영업") |
실전! IF와 AND의 만남
"출석이 90% 이상이고 시험 점수가 70점 이상인 사람만 수료증 발급"이라는 미션을 수행해 봅시다.
이렇게 논리 연산자를 섞어 쓰면 수식이 훨씬 깔끔해지고, 복잡한 조건도 한 줄로 멋지게 해결할 수 있습니다.
4. 실무 효율을 200% 높여주는 작성 팁과 주의사항
이론은 쉽지만, 실제로 수식을 쓰다 보면 괄호 개수 때문에 머리가 아픈 경우가 많죠. 여러분의 칼퇴를 도와줄 꿀팁 몇 가지를 공유합니다.
💡 전문가의 비밀 팁:
- 괄호 색상을 확인하세요: 엑셀은 짝이 맞는 괄호끼리 같은 색상으로 표시해 줍니다. 마지막 괄호는 항상 검은색이어야 한다는 점을 잊지 마세요!
- IFS 함수(Excel 2019 이상): 중첩 IF가 너무 길어진다면
=IFS(조건1, 결과1, 조건2, 결과2...)를 사용해 보세요. 훨씬 가독성이 좋아집니다. - 줄 바꿈을 활용하세요: 수식 입력줄에서
Alt + Enter를 누르면 수식 안에서 줄을 바꿀 수 있습니다. 복잡한 중첩 구조를 계단식으로 정리하면 오류 찾기가 훨씬 쉽습니다.
5. 결론 및 요약
오늘은 엑셀의 핵심 기능인 IF 함수 중첩 사용법과 논리 연산자(AND, OR, NOT)를 결합하는 방법을 알아보았습니다. 복잡해 보이지만 딱 세 가지만 기억하세요!
- IF 중첩은 큰 범위(중요한 조건)부터 처리한다.
- 여러 조건이 동시에 필요할 땐 AND, 하나만 필요할 땐 OR를 IF 안에 넣는다.
- 수식이 꼬일 땐 괄호의 짝과 색상을 확인한다.
이제 여러분도 수많은 데이터를 단 몇 초 만에 분류하고 분석할 수 있는 '엑셀 능력자'의 길로 들어서셨습니다. 오늘 배운 내용을 바로 자신의 업무 파일에 적용해 보세요!
6. 자주 묻는 질문(FAQ)
Q1. 중첩 IF 함수는 최대 몇 개까지 가능한가요?
A: 엑셀 최신 버전 기준으로 최대 64개까지 중첩이 가능합니다. 하지만 가독성을 위해 3~4개 이상은 IFS 함수나 VLOOKUP을 사용하는 것을 권장합니다.
Q2. 수식을 입력했는데 #VALUE! 오류가 떠요.
A: 주로 텍스트 형식과 숫자 형식이 충돌할 때 발생합니다. 숫자를 비교할 때 따옴표("")를 붙이지 않았는지, 혹은 셀에 텍스트가 섞여 있지 않은지 확인해 보세요.
Q3. AND와 OR를 한 수식에 같이 써도 되나요?
A: 네, 물론입니다! 예: =IF(OR(AND(A1>10, B1>10), C1="VIP"), "통과", "보류") 처럼 복합적인 논리 구성이 가능합니다.

[엑셀] - 엑셀 조건부 서식 완벽 가이드: 데이터를 시각적으로 강조하는 최고의 방법
엑셀 조건부 서식 완벽 가이드: 데이터를 시각적으로 강조하는 최고의 방법
목차1. 엑셀 조건부 서식이란 무엇인가?2. 초보자를 위한 핵심 기본 기능 활용법3. 중급자를 위한 수식 기반 조건부 서식 활용4. 업무 효율을 2배 높이는 실전 응용 사례5. 자주 묻는 질문(FAQ)1. 엑
cognitifact.tistory.com
[엑셀] - 엑셀 매크로 및 VBA 입문: 반복 업무 자동화로 퇴근 시간을 앞당기는 마법
엑셀 매크로 및 VBA 입문: 반복 업무 자동화로 퇴근 시간을 앞당기는 마법
목차1. 왜 우리는 엑셀 자동화에 주목해야 할까요?2. 매크로 기록기: 코딩 없이 시작하는 자동화의 첫걸음3. VBA의 세계로: 매크로의 심장을 이해하기4. VBA 기본 문법과 구조: 변수, 조건문, 반복문5
cognitifact.tistory.com
[엑셀] - 엑셀 VLOOKUP 함수 완벽 가이드: 초보부터 고수까지, 오류 해결과 실전 활용법
엑셀 VLOOKUP 함수 완벽 가이드: 초보부터 고수까지, 오류 해결과 실전 활용법
목차1. 들어가며: 왜 VLOOKUP은 직장인의 필수 생존템인가?2. VLOOKUP 함수의 기본 구조와 4가지 인수 파헤치기3. 실전 예제로 배우는 VLOOKUP 활용법4. #N/A, #REF! 오류 정복하기: 원인과 해결책5. VLOOKUP의
cognitifact.tistory.com
[엑셀] - 직장인 필수 엑셀 단축키 모음 Top 50: 칼퇴를 부르는 마법의 리스트
직장인 필수 엑셀 단축키 모음 Top 50: 칼퇴를 부르는 마법의 리스트
직장인의 업무 속도를 200% 끌어올려 줄 마법 같은 엑셀 단축키 50가지를 지금 바로 확인해보세요. 이 리스트만 있으면 마우스는 거의 필요 없습니다!목차 (Quick Navigation)1. 왜 엑셀 단축키가 '생존
cognitifact.tistory.com
'엑셀' 카테고리의 다른 글
| 엑셀 중복 값 찾기 및 한 번에 삭제하는 법 (데이터 관리 달인 되기) (0) | 2026.04.14 |
|---|---|
| 대용량 엑셀 파일 속도 느려짐 해결 방법 7가지 (업무 효율 200% 올리는 비법) (0) | 2026.04.13 |
| 엑셀 조건부 서식 완벽 가이드: 데이터를 시각적으로 강조하는 최고의 방법 (1) | 2026.04.12 |
| 엑셀 매크로 및 VBA 입문: 반복 업무 자동화로 퇴근 시간을 앞당기는 마법 (0) | 2026.04.12 |
| 엑셀 VLOOKUP 함수 완벽 가이드: 초보부터 고수까지, 오류 해결과 실전 활용법 (1) | 2026.04.12 |